Προγραμματισμός

* Γνώση Υπολογιστών >> Προγραμματισμός >> C /C + + Προγραμματισμός

Πώς να κάνει Cin.Fail

Όταν χρησιμοποιείτε cin στο C + + προγράμματα , περιμένετε το χρήστη να εισάγει έναν ακέραιο . Εάν οι χρήστες εισέρχεται κάτι άλλο , όπως ένα e-mail , το πρόγραμμά σας δεν θα ξέρει πώς να διαβάζει την είσοδο . Cin.Fail επαναφέρει τη λειτουργία , έτσι ώστε ο χρήστης να μπορεί να επαναλάβετε την καταχώρηση . Ωστόσο , αν δεν κάνετε cin.fail σωστά , τότε θα δημιουργήσει ένα άπειρο βρόχο . Για να αποφευχθεί αυτό , θα πρέπει να καθαρίσετε την αποτυχημένη είσοδο . Οδηγίες
Η

1 Ανοίξτε το C + + script 2

Πληκτρολογήστε την ακόλουθη άμεσα κάτω από τη λειτουργία cin : .

Αν ( cin.fail ( ) ) { cin.clear ( ) ? cin.ignore ( 1000 , '\\ n' )? συνεχίσει? }
εικόνων 3

Αποθηκεύστε και κλείστε το C + + script
εικόνων .
Η

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α